The optics are indeed the same.. They are still the FPL-53 80mm F/7.5 doublet that has earned its spot as one of the most widely used astro-photography tools...

As Darrell just said.. get the gold ED80 Pro for less than half the cost of the Black Diamond ED80, spend $250 on a william optics 10:1 crayford and what you end up with is a scope for $750 that has the same optics and a better focuser than one advertised for $1200 odd...
